【Warning: Module 'mysqli' already loaded in Unknown on line 0】教程文章相关的互联网学习教程文章

简单介绍下PHP5中引入的MYSQLI_PHP教程【图】

在新下载的PHP5中你会发现多了一个mysqli.dll,它是干什么用的呢?我简单介绍下:mysqli.dll是PHP对mysql新特性的一个扩展支持。在PHP5中可以在php.ini中加载,如下图:, interface, ingenious, incompatible or incomplete(改扩展仍在开发中,因为MYSQL4。1和MYSQL5都没有正式推出尚在开发中,新的特性没有完全实现)mysqli想实现的目标具体有:-更简单的维护-更好的兼容性-向后兼容mysql(指PHP中的模块)发展到现在显得比较凌乱...

php连接到MySQL数据库服务器时三种主要的API:mysql,mysqli,pdo区别及联系_PHP教程

Overview 这一部分对在PHP应用开发过程中需要和Mysql数据库交互时可用的选择进行一个简单介绍。 什么是API? 一个应用程序接口(Application Programming Interface的缩写),定义了类,方法,函数,变量等等一切 你的应用程序中为了完成特定任务而需要调用的内容。在PHP应用程序需要和数据库进行交互的时候所需要的API 通常是通过PHP扩展暴露出来(给终端PHP程序员调用)。 API可以是面向过程的,也可以是面向对象的。对于面向过程...

PHPMySQLintegration_PHP教程

1. copy php(做为现在的主流开发语言)/php(做为现在的主流开发语言)5ts.dll and libMySQL(和PHP搭配之最佳组合).dll into windows/system322. in php(做为现在的主流开发语言).ini#find extension=php(做为现在的主流开发语言)_MySQL(和PHP搭配之最佳组合).dll and add a new line:extension=php(做为现在的主流开发语言)_MySQL(和PHP搭配之最佳组合)i.dllA detail step by step link:http://a51.neostrada.pl/ http://www.b...

PHPmysql与mysqli事务使用说明_PHP教程

首先, mysqli 连接是永久连接,而mysql是非永久连接。什么意思呢? mysql连接每当第二次使用的时候,都会重新打开一个新的进程,而mysqli则只使用同一个进程,这样可以很大程度的减轻服务器端压力。mysqli封装了诸如事务等一些高级操作,同时封装了DB操作过程中的很多可用的方法。 应用比较多的地方是 mysqli的事务。 比如下面的示例:代码如下$mysqli = new mysqli(localhost,root,,DB_Lib2Test); $mysqli->autocommit(false);//...

PHP中mysqli_affected_rows作用行数返回值_PHP教程

本文章来给各位同学介绍关于PHP中mysqli_affected_rows作用行数返回值,有需要了解的朋友可参考。mysqli中关于update操作影响的行数可以有两种返回形式: 1. 返回匹配的行数 2. 返回影响的行数 默认情况下mysqli_affected_rows返回的值为影响的行数,如果我们需要返回匹配的行数,可以使用mysqli_real_connect函数进行数据库连接的初始化,并在函数的flag参数位加上:MYSQLI_CLIENT_FOUND_ROWS return number of matched rows, not ...

phpmysqli批量执行sql语句程序代码_PHP教程

本文章来给各位同学介绍PHP mysqli批量执行sql语句程序代码,有需要了解的朋友可参考参考。mysqli 增强-批量执行sql 语句代码如下//mysqli 增强-批量执行sql 语句//批量执行dql//使用mysqli的mysqli::multi_query() 一次性添加3个用户$mysqli =new MySQLi("localhost","root","root","test");if($mysqli->connect_error){die ("连接失败".$mysqli->connect_error);}//注意分号$sqls="insert into user1 (name,password,email,age) v...

phpmysqli入门应用实现_PHP教程

php的mysqli扩展被封装到一个类中,是一种面向对象的技术,执行速度更快,与传统的过程化方法相比更方便也更高效默认情况下mysqli在php是未开启的我们需在 要在PHP中使用mysqli扩展,需要在配置文件php.ini中添加如下的设置:代码如下extension=php_mysqli.dll如果配置文件中已有上述设置,确保extension前面没有“;”,否则将其去掉。下面开始介绍如何使用mysqli扩展来存取数据库,即可了.代码如下 $db_host="localhost"; ...

mysqlint保存数据技巧_PHP教程

public function insert($data) { if(isset($data['content'])&&!empty($data['content'])) { $data_for_query['content'] = trim($data['content']); } else { return false; } if(isset($data['user_id'])&&!empty($data['user_id'])) { $data_for_query['user_id'] = intval($data['user_id']); } else { return false; } $sql = "insert into `".$this->table_name."` (".$this->db->implodetocolumn(array_...

mysqlint取值范围与phpintval区别_PHP教程

php教程 intval的取值范围:与操作系统相关,32位系统上为-2147483648到2147483647,64位系统上为-9223372036854775808到9223372036854775807。 mysql教程 int取值范围:与操作系统无关,为-2147483648到2147483647,无符号为0到4294967295。 mysql bigint取值范围:与操作系统无关,为-9223372036854775808到9223372036854775807,无符号为0到18446744073709551615。 http://www.bkjia.com/PHPjc/630768.htmlwww.bkjia.comtrueh...

phpmyadmin提示无法载入mysqli扩展解决方法_PHP教程

在使用phpmyadmin中我们有时会看到有这种提示无法载入mysqli扩展,下面我来总结解决办法。mysqli为php的mysql扩展的加强版.性能比mysql系列函数要好的多. 1、首先装你的php目录下的php.ini-dist复制到C:WINNT(win2003,winxp,win98应该是相应的系统目录)下 2、将刚才的php.ini-dist后面的”-dist”去掉,再用记事本打开,搜索”php_mysqli.dll”去掉前面的”;”保存 3、将C\:phpext(此处应为你的php目录)目录下的php_mysql.dll复...

phpMyAdmin缺少mysqli扩展。请检查PHP配置的解决方案_PHP教程

phpMyAdmin 缺少 mysqli 扩展。请检查 PHP 配置 的解决方案 有需要的朋友可参考一下。phpMyAdmin 缺少 mysqli 扩展。请检查 PHP 配置 的解决方案: 缺少 mysqli 扩展。请检查 PHP 配置。 打开你的php.ini->一般在C:WINDOWS目录下。 找到代码如下;extension=php_msql.dll ;extension=php_mssql.dll extension=php_mysql.dll extension=php_mysqli.dll需要开启哪个扩展,就把这一行前面的分号去掉就行,注意要重启Apache 或者IIS解决步...

phpmysqli批量替换数据库表前缀实例_PHP教程

在php中有时我们要替换数据库中表前缀但是又不苦于一个个表去修改前缀吧,下面我自己写了一个mysqli批量替换数据库表前缀的php程序,希望些方法对你有帮助。 代码如下header ( 'http-equiv="Content-Type" content="text/html; charset=utf-8"' ); $DB_host = "localhost"; //数据库主机 $DB_user = "root"; //数据库用户 $DB_psw = "root3306"; //数据库密码 $DB_datebase = "gk_yue39_com"; //数据库名 $DB_charset = "utf8"; //...

php中不能加载php_mysql.dll、php_mysqli.dll解决方法_PHP教程

今天刚配置的php环境结果在php启动时无法加载php_mysql.dll、php_mysqli.dll了,这个我配置是没有问题呀,下面我来给大家介绍php_mysql.dll、php_mysqli.dll无法加载解决方法。今天启动php环境时,发现mysql模块功能不能使用,网站返回500错误。查看了下apache下错误日志。发现下面一段错误信息: PHP Warning: PHP Startup: Unable to load dynamic library D:/wwwserver/php/ext//php_mysql.dll - /xd5/xd2/xb2/xbb/xb5/xbd/xd6/...

PHP数据库操作之基于Mysqli的数据库操作类库_PHP教程

此类库简单、易用,便于你自己修改和对功能的改善,能解决大部分 PHP 项目中执行的 SQL 操作。 初步工作 首先,请大家下载这个类库 M.class.php 再下载一个 Mysqli 连接数据库的类库 MysqliDb.class.php(打包下载地址) 新建一个 includes 的文件夹,将下载下来的两个 class 文件,放进去。 然后,请你在项目下创建一个 test.php 文件。注:UTF-8 文件格式 请先根据你机器的情况,填充以下代码,用于连接数据库: 代码如下:header(...

php操作mysqli(示例代码)_PHP教程

define("MYSQL_OPEN_LOGS",true); class mysqliHelp { private $db; public function __construct() { //如果要查询日志log的话,怎么办 } public function __get($name ) { //echo "__GET:",$name; if(in_array($name,array("db"),true))//或者isset($this->$name) return $this->$name; return null; } public function connect($host,$user,$pass,$db,$charSet='utf...